摘要:

This paper evaluates the atmospheric drying of particulate material, such as coir dust or milled peat. in flat beds ( spreads). A mathematical model is presented that defines the relationship between the optimum yield of product and the prevailing weather conditions. A method is presented that enables the production manager to establish the optimum crop yield for a given drying cycle. When applied to milled peat. this method has shown a yield increase in excess of 10%.
